您的位置:首页 >科技 >

Java串口通信(RXTX) 📡_rxtx官网

导读 随着物联网技术的发展,串口通信在各种应用场景中变得越来越重要。为了方便开发者在Java环境中进行串口通信开发,RXTX库应运而生。本文将带

随着物联网技术的发展,串口通信在各种应用场景中变得越来越重要。为了方便开发者在Java环境中进行串口通信开发,RXTX库应运而生。本文将带你了解如何使用RXTX库进行Java串口通信,并提供一些实用技巧,帮助你更高效地完成项目。

首先,访问RXTX官网下载适用于你的操作系统的RXTX库。官网提供了详细的安装指南和API文档,确保你能够快速上手。📚

接下来,在你的Java项目中引入RXTX库。如果你使用的是Eclipse或IntelliJ IDEA等集成开发环境,只需将下载好的jar文件添加到项目的构建路径即可。💡

然后,你可以开始编写Java代码来实现串口通信了。下面是一个简单的示例,展示如何打开一个串口并发送数据:

```java

import gnu.io.CommPortIdentifier;

import gnu.io.SerialPort;

public class SerialCommExample {

public static void main(String[] args) {

try {

CommPortIdentifier portId = CommPortIdentifier.getPortIdentifier("COM3");

SerialPort serialPort = (SerialPort) portId.open("SerialCommExample", 2000);

serialPort.setSerialPortParams(9600, SerialPort.DATABITS_8, SerialPort.STOPBITS_1, SerialPort.PARITY_NONE);

// 发送数据

serialPort.getOutputStream().write("Hello, World!".getBytes());

} catch (Exception e) {

e.printStackTrace();

}

}

}

```

通过上述步骤,你就可以利用RXTX库在Java项目中实现串口通信了。希望这篇指南对你有所帮助!🚀

版权声明:转载此文是出于传递更多信息之目的。若有来源标注错误或侵犯了您的合法权益,请作者持权属证明与本网联系,我们将及时更正、删除,谢谢您的支持与理解。
关键词: